Output 307ffc953b8fbd7fdfddece34badfc18d12663df9a62d64ebdd40c80e9c63c63:1

value
28059687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cc5d57c64cf19f3ed745018208df80495180053 OP_EQUAL
address
MEu6akYwR23tucHfeQz2o3WJ5vaKptznBv
transaction
307ffc953b8fbd7fdfddece34badfc18d12663df9a62d64ebdd40c80e9c63c63
spent
true